Men's Soccer Falls in Conference Opener

Box Score Box Score

SPRINGIELD, Mass. – The Western New England men's soccer team used a balanced scoring attack to open up conference play with an impressive 4-0 win over New England College.

Freshman forward Andrew Rose (Farmington, CT) got the scoring started for the Golden Bears as he buried home a rebound opportunity in the 13th minute. WNEC struck again before the half as freshman forward Jake Bartnik (East Longmeadow, MA) tucked a shot in the bottom right corner in the 39th minute.

Senior midfielder Justin Martins (Ludlow, MA) wasted no time as 1:23 in to the second half he finished on a beautiful cross from junior Eric Marcelino (Farmington, CT) that was set up by senior midfielder Alex Dos Santos (Ludlow, MA). The final goal was scored by junior forward Austin Santolini (Agawam, MA) off a feed from Jake Bartnik.

Pilgrim goalkeeper Pat Harkin (Scituate, RI) made six saves, while WNEC freshman Domenic Villano (Bronxville, NY) recorded the shutout with four saves.

With the victory WNEC improves their record to 2-2-1 (1-0 TCCC), while the Pilgrims fall to 2-2 (0-1 TCCC).
